Output 477938de6846b320b9101e6fad03ab12970b680f05837a139cc2ccd702f52c24:0

value
53718299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a42d6d52190f62d66392a3a3570e1693cd5908 OP_EQUAL
address
3CWLLRq6WtqXZf43Hdpekoyhxf1uYK5hPt
transaction
477938de6846b320b9101e6fad03ab12970b680f05837a139cc2ccd702f52c24
confirmations
294280
spent
true